Three Of Pentacles Meaning | Upright | Context - Spirituality | Position - Past

The Three of Pentacles is a card that represents learning, studying, and apprenticeship in the context of spirituality. It signifies the effort and dedication you have put into your spiritual development, and the rewards that come from that commitment.

Building a Strong Foundation

In the past, you have worked hard to build a strong foundation in your spiritual practices. You have dedicated yourself to learning and studying new spiritual techniques, and this has laid the groundwork for your current spiritual journey. Your commitment to your spiritual growth has paid off, and you are now reaping the rewards of your efforts.
